Перейти к содержанию

Рекомендуемые сообщения

 

image.png.1b04a977ec08f3c8c8434a6c3fbc7351.png 

 

Инструмент для быстрого редактирования и экспорта raw форматов сталкера

Поддерживаемые форматы:

1. object

2. ogf

3. omf

4. skl

5. skls

6. bones

7. dm

8. obj (wavefront)

9. ltx (bone parts)

 

Возможности:

1. Экспорт ogf без сжатия (HQ Geometry+), обычный HQ Geometry тоже патченный, экспортирует лучше чем СДК

2. Сохранение и загрузка .bones настроек

3. Загрузка, сохранение, удаление skls анимаций

4. Экспорт анимаций в 8, 16 бит и без сжатия

5. По умолчанию отключена оптимизация мешей с одинаковыми текстурами и шейдерами, при экспорте они не будут объединяться в один, чтобы была возможность отредактировать их в OGF Editor

6. Настройка и генерация коллизии (после настройки шейпов нужно нажать Shape Params->Generate shapes)

7. Добавлена возможность изменять размер моделей и анимаций при экспорте, с сохранением модификатора в .object

8. Возможность назначить на формат .object

9. Редактирование Userdata

10. Редактирование Lod

11. Редактирование Motion refs

12. Экспорт моделей с оригинальными нормалями без иксреевских групп сглаживания

13. Генерация лод моделей

 

Работа с оригинальными нормалями моделей:

Для использования оригинальных нормалей модели вместо смуз групп нужно установить плагин для блендера https://github.com/PavelBlend/blender-xray (на момент 14.07.22 нужно скачать zip code вместо релиза, или же релиз вышедший позже 14.07.22). После установки в настройках плагина во вкладке Others поставить галочку на use split normals. Теперь ogf будет с оригинальными нормалями из исходника.

 

В паре с OGF Editor и OMF Editor потребность в сдк практически исчезла

Спойлер

Настройки программы

image.png.2463faa12dafdb4c89755f882de05ab8.png

Панель текстур

image.png.62f6ffdb18ee0055ab5699316074d29c.png

Панель костей

image.png.eccc31e5a526a0892013e8295a7bd1bb.png

Загруженные анимации

image.png.174b1b32167ba794de7a2d2377f027c5.png

Моушн референсы

image.png.6032aea449864bec1075e6b3c68f3f42.png

Юзердата

image.png.cb8ad34c339502cbd3d66ebb8ad13835.png

Ссылка на лод

image.png.8a6660168c3eeb79b33ddbb175986ed7.png

Информация об объекте

image.png.790e19c2004fde92e32d79fdefb2d5f7.png

 

 

 

 

Спойлер

В версии 2.2 был добавлен экспорт анимаций без сжатия (No compress) который доступен в STCoP Engine с открытым исходным кодом, и не поддерживается оригинальными движками.

Если вы пользуетесь STCoP Engine или портировали к себе возможность загрузки подобных анимаций, то для включения этой функции в Object Editor необходимо в корне программы изменить параметр developer в Settings.ini на 1

Скачать: https://github.com/VaIeroK/XrayExportTool/releases/latest

Исходный код: https://github.com/VaIeroK/XrayExportTool

 

Изменено пользователем ValeroK
v4.1

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Обновление 3.9

1. Исправлен нерабочий экспорт Obj

2. Добавлено влияние HQ Geometry параметров на Obj, DM, Static OGF

3. Добавлен скейл для Static OGF, Obj

4. Новый Help

5. Добавлен многопоток для экспорта моделей имеющих множество текстур, многопоточный Make Progressive

6. Добавлен лог который находится во вкладке Flags при развертывании программы вниз

7. Исправлен редкий баг криво загружавший вкладку Bones, впоследствии вылет при экспорте

8. Фикс объединения старых и новых параметров Object Info, вкладок Surfaces при загрузке нового объекта

9. Вывод времени компиляции в сообщении и логе

10. Добавлено сочетание клавиш Ctrl+Del которое останавливает процесс работы с моделью

11. Вырезана многопоточная загрузка, выдавала редкие вылеты. Так же пропала нужда в ней

12. Добавлен флаг Make Stripify для статической геометрии

13. Исправлен нерабочий режим Form File Dialog у Batch Converter

14. Обновление интерфейса

Просьба сообщать про любые ошибки, вылеты и зависания программы!

image.thumb.png.8ca09a6fd92a156e565d9b2087ca93bc.png

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

ValeroK 
Это ты вот про это мне говорил, что не хочешь перегружать интерфейс, да?)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

HollowKrueger Я тогда даже представить не мог что программа перерастет в это 🙂

Ну и по умолчанию остался уменьшенный визуал

image.png.0a6fe3c82ba13c614ec0903a87cf2893.png

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

ValeroK 
а возможность параметры к анимация подгружать так и не прикрутил:(

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

HollowKrueger Может добавлю в ближайших обновлениях, но сейчас так же в разработке новая вкладка костей с полным дубликатом параметров из СДК, и возможностью создавать скелет и привязывать статический object

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

ValeroK 
О, звучит интересно. Ждемс, со скелетом особенно интересно- если появится возможность вязать статические кости к существующим моделям, то это топ. Т.к. реэкспорт анимаций уже в печенках сидит)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Обновление 3.95

1. Добавлен многопоточный Batch Converter, время компиляции ускорено в 8+ раз

2. Снято ограничение на максимальное колличество вертексов в 65535

3. Переделан лог, пофикшены баги и вылеты связанные с ним

4. Фикс вылетов Ctrl+Del

5. Оптимизация меша при генерации Lod модели

6. Лог теперь виден по умочланию


Дополнено 46 минуты спустя

Upd: Обновил архив в 3.95 релизе. Пофиксил неработающий Batch From File Dialog

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Обновление 3.96

1. Исправлен экспорт битых DM

2. Добавлен скейл для DM

3. Добавлено больше логов для некоторых режимов

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Обновление 4.0

1. Добавлена кнопка View для просмотра модели (Help->View опишет все тонкости)

2. Исправлена рандомная сортировка мешей при экспорте моделей от GSC, теперь меши будут экспортироваться по порядку из Object (теперь можно пользоваться Import Params в OGF Editor)

3. Фикс дебаг вкладки


Дополнено 28 минуты спустя

Upd: Архив релиза 4.0 обновлен. Исправлен редкий вылет при выборе fs.ltx в настройках программы


Дополнено 32 минуты спустя

Обновление 4.05

Снято ограничение количества полигонов для статических мешей

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Обновление 4.1

1. Добавлено автоопределение типа сглаживания, в 95% случаев выдает правильный тип. Чаще всего ошибается с хайполи моделями (400к+ полигонов) и с моделями не имеющими закруглений (модели состоящие из плейнов, квадратов и прямоугольников). Можно выставить в настройках по дефолту
2. Model Viewer выведен в отдельный поток благодаря чему исправились зависания на некоторых моделях

Изменено пользователем ValeroK

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у